Prep Time: 10 Minutes Cook Time: 25 Minutes |
Ready In: 35 Minutes Servings: 4 |
|
Sauteed chicken breast and mushrooms simmered in a mandarin orange mixture. Ingredients:
1 cup fresh broccoli florets |
1 tablespoon butter |
2 pounds skinless, boneless chicken breast meat - cubed |
1 1/2 cups sliced fresh mushrooms |
3 teaspoons all-purpose flour |
2/3 cup water |
1/3 cup undiluted, thawed orange juice concentrate |
2 cubes chicken bouillon |
1 (11 ounce) can mandarin orange segments, drained |
1/4 cup sliced green onion |
Directions:
1. Place broccoli in a steamer over 1 inch of boiling water, and cover. Cook until tender but still firm, about 2 to 6 minutes. Drain, cool and set aside. 2. Heat butter in a large skillet over medium high heat. Saute chicken in butter until browned. Remove from skillet and set aside. 3. Saute mushrooms in skillet for 1 minute; remove from skillet and set aside. Stir in flour, water, orange juice concentrate and seasoning. 4. Heat to boiling, stirring. Simmer, stirring, for 4 minutes. Return chicken and mushrooms to skillet; stir in orange segments, green onion and broccoli. Heat through and serve. |
